    Special thanks to the Peoria Police Officers Association Charities, which invited Centennial Student Council members to participate in its 20th annual Shop With a Cop event. With help from generous donors like former Coyote Head Nurse Lisa Alexander, Centennial was able to take 51 children to breakfast, to see Santa and to go shopping at Target. For the 6th consecutive year, our irreplaceable Student Government Advisor Mr. Berquam and awesome Student Council officers sacrificed their Saturday morning to support this community event.


Meet Centennial's Next Assistant Principal & Athletic Director

  • Dear Coyote Families,

     

    As you may know, our district recently selected Dr. Adam Larsen to serve as Peoria Unified’s next Director of Facilities & Maintenance. Dr. Larsen will continue to support Centennial this school year. In the meantime, we have worked with site staff members and district administrators to search for the right person to fill his role as Centennial’s next Assistant Principal and Athletic Director. I want thank everyone who participated in this process, helping to provide feedback.

    After a thorough selection process, we are excited to welcome Mr. Darien Schoolcraft to the Coyote community as our next Athletic Director. Mr. Schoolcraft started his teaching career in 2009 as a PE teacher in the Phoenix area, transitioning to PUSD in 2013.  He has coached high school and elementary Football, Basketball, Baseball, Softball and Track, serving both male and female athletes.  For the last eight years, Darien has served as an administrator, including three years as assistant principal and the last five years as Principal of Apache Elementary.  He has worked diligently over these years to build positive culture that allows students to thrive academically and through sports, clubs, and activities.

    I am grateful to the multiple qualified candidates who sought to serve in this role and who have demonstrated significant contributions to PUSD. Our team chose Mr. Schoolcraft because of his leadership experience, commitment to student support, focus on quality instruction, and track record of serving teachers and coaches. Darien will build strong relationships with our students and staff and work tirelessly to support them. Mr. Schoolcraft’s transition to this new role will occur later this coming spring, closer to the end of the school year. Dr. Larsen will continue to support Centennial until that time. 

    We look forward to witnessing the positive impact that Mr. Schoolcraft will have on our school and its athletic program. Please join me in welcoming him into our Coyote Family! We plan to introduce him to all of you very soon. Thank you,

  • deca service day

    Last Monday, Centennial DECA served our community, cleaning litter from the side of the road. The students walked a mile along 83rd Ave between Cactus and Thunderbird, in honor of a street that was adopted by a Centennial family. The students collected 17 bags of trash to help keep our community clean.
